Transaction 21d229a673b41e5148b5a6495ac5af59279d60d75dbc372892bf78f6eb732e19
4 Input
2 Outputs
- 21d229a673b41e5148b5a6495ac5af59279d60d75dbc372892bf78f6eb732e19:0
- 21d229a673b41e5148b5a6495ac5af59279d60d75dbc372892bf78f6eb732e19:1
value 2494390
address 19hPkZQic2TRXMmpp5y3kdypDaqjApMruc
value 1514612
address 1HQSwKfGEAyDyrSoBadXfvxdXHRyDF2vgj